I’ll set the stage… within my AGOL for Organizations account, I created a Web Map (name: GIS Viewer - which is the web map I’m using within my Web AppBuilder application). I downloaded the Web AppBuilder for ArcGIS (Developer Edition) and went through the initial “Get Started” page (https://developers.arcgis.com/web-appbuilder/guide/getstarted.htm ). I started Node.js (which spawned Web AppBuilder in browser), specified my portal (AGOL for Org. url), and was then prompted for an App ID. After some reading, I created a Web Mapping Application in AGOL (name: GIS Viewer_WAB) and Registered the app and set the redirect URI’s, then copied the App ID into the text box within the Web AppBuilder. Everything worked fine for a while.
Now, within AGOL, the Web Mapping Application (GIS Viewer_WAB) was deleted. I deleted it because I was having some issues with basemaps and thought it was the app and wanted to start from scratch. I thought I could delete it and create a new one, register that app in AGOL and then update the App ID in the signininfo.json file located within the \arcgis-web-appbuilder-1.0\server folder on my machine. Now, when I start Node.js, the Web AppBuilder page within the browser is blank.
Anyone have some thoughts on what could/should be done to be able to view the stemapp again via Node.js?
